Playground Games have been showcasing plenty of Forza Horizon 5 content ever since the game was announced at Xbox Games Showcase earlier this year. The team already released a couple of developer vlogs, where they talked about the sound design, biomes, weather and skyboxes.
The next episode of this dev vlog series named Let's Go! Forza Horizon 5 is set to be premiered today, where the team will show us the full map of Forza Horizon 5, which is 50 per cent larger than the map in Forza Horizon 4.
The team also revealed that due to the size of the map, players can expect a lot more off-road racing but also road racing overall. The proportions of each are similar to Forza Horizon 4, Playground Games stated when asked about off-road racing.
"The map is 50% larger than in Forza Horizon 4, so there will be more off-roading and road racing overall, however, the proportions of each are comparable to previous games."
